Transaction 3ec43079c92dc759340a86980439fb0aca4182337720ed49990f163ac23a680a

2 Input
2 Outputs
  • 3ec43079c92dc759340a86980439fb0aca4182337720ed49990f163ac23a680a:0
  • value  1190000
    address  1MTt8ZJYKKwfogpZwohGwKf3TjK8cDzxrz
  • 3ec43079c92dc759340a86980439fb0aca4182337720ed49990f163ac23a680a:1
  • value  1842035
    address  3PFdsBie94UDw3ZPmEvXZ8MF4a2oqau9jR